Job Description
Vision and Purpose 
Full time: Permanent - 7.45am-4.30pm - Mon-Fri - Term Time Only
Reporting to: PA to the Principal
Responsibilities- We are looking for an experienced receptionist and administrator who can oversee the main reception and provide guidance and support to the reception staff and coordination the day-to-day workflow of the administration staff.
- To ensure a welcoming, calm and professional reception environment is maintained at all times.
- To support the day-to-day organisation of the school office and reception area.
- To provide guidance and support to the Receptionists and Administration officers.
- Co-ordinate and oversee the reprographics and administrative workflows.
- To have responsibility for overseeing the day-to-day operation of the main reception and office procedures ensuring safeguarding processes are adhered to.
- To further develop an efficient administrative support system, realising and deploying the potential of IT and other technologies in the administration of the Academy.
- Maintain effective communication with the PA to the Principal to support smooth office functioning. Respond positively to feedback and pass on concerns to the PA when appropriate.
- To take responsibility to ensure the main reception office is organised, tidy and inviting. To be proficient in a range of systems, Excel, Word, Arbor, CPOMS.
- To oversee maintenance and transfer of student records / archives. Ensure they are maintained to a high standard by the administrative support officer confirming when children leave the academy their file is transferred to the new school or college as soon as possible with secure transit and confirmation of receipt obtained.
- To carry out word processing, data entry and ICT based tasks.
- To support in the invigilation of tests and examinations, to accompany staff and pupils on educational visits.
- To support the school's first aid function as a registered first aider and supporting pupils with specific medical conditions, e.g. diabetes.
- To support after school events such as parent's evening, open evenings etc. To undertake the necessary training involved with the post.
- You will also need to be committed to teamwork, very well organised, with an excellent work ethic as well as an effective communicator working with staff, pupils and parents.
- Individuals have a responsibility for promoting and safeguarding the welfare of children and young people he/she is responsible for or comes into contact with. To ensure all tasks are carried out with due regard to Health and Safety. To ensure that the highest standards of confidentiality are maintained when dealing with information relating to pupils and/or staff. To understand and act in accordance with the school's equal opportunities policies. To undertake any reasonable task requested by the Principal / SLT or line manager.
- Please note this role does not carry direct line management responsibilities.
- Proficiency in a range of systems, including Excel, Word, Arbor, CPOMS.
- Experience in administration, reception duties, safeguarding processes and records management.
- Ability to develop efficient administrative support systems and utilise IT and other technologies in administration.
- Strong communication and organisational skills; ability to work with staff, pupils and parents.
- Commitment to teamwork, health and safety, confidentiality and equal opportunities policies.
